Analysis
Sint Maarten (Dutch part) recorded -6.75 % change on previous year for total assets, adjusted using imf accounting records (assets) in 2021.
That represents a change of down 158.5% on the previous year and down 149.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, total assets, adjusted using imf accounting records (assets) in Sint Maarten (Dutch part) peaked at 14.72 % change on previous year in 2017 and was at its lowest, -20.8 % change on previous year, in 2019.
Sint Maarten (Dutch part) ranks 163rd of 172 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Total assets, Adjusted using IMF accounting records (Assets, Positions, US dollar).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
